ACE INA is the U.S. –based division of the ACE Group of Companies, which provides insurance and reinsurance for a diverse group of clients around the world. Through subsidiaries of the ACE Group of Companies, ACE INA offers a broad array of sophisticated property, casualty, accident and health, and financial products, and risk management services to corporate and consumer clients across the U.S. A global insurance & risk management company, ACE has offices in over 50 countries and doing business in 130 countries.
